Meet Rex — a 10–12 week old Blue Heeler mix with a big brain and a sneaky streak.

Rex is an independent little guy who’s perfectly happy playing with other dogs or entertaining himself with a toy or a backyard patrol. He’s clever, curious, and just a tiny bit mischievous — when he knows it’s bedtime, he may run and hide like it’s a game of hide-and-seek he plans to win.

He’s super sweet, especially when he’s tired. That’s when the zoomies fade and the snuggles kick in. Rex loves curling up close and gazing up at you with those sleepy puppy eyes right before he drifts off. 💤

Potty training is coming along great — while there may be daytime accidents when his foster is at work, he always goes potty outside when taken out and is catching on fast. This pup is smart, observant, and eager to learn.

If you’re looking for a confident, clever, and cuddly little sidekick, Rex might just be your guy.


Adoption fee includes neuter, microchip, vaccinations

Our Mission
We are a non-profit animal rescue and transport committed to saving homeless companion animals, assisting other shelters/rescues through rescue transports, offering low-cost spay/neuter services for our community, and educating the public on the issues of pet over-population, responsible pet ownership and puppy mills.
